Kids

Our kids’ church programme runs during the Victorian school term at both campuses.
We cater for children from kindergarten age to grade 6, with the kids joining the service initially for worship and going off to kids’ church after the announcements. Activity packs are available when kids’ church isn’t on.

All volunteers at TVBC have undergone Child Safe training.

Youth

High schoolers – come and join The Vine Youth on Friday evenings between 6:30 and 8:45 pm at our Eltham campus! This is a relaxed, safe environment where you can get to know other kids and ask questions about life and faith without judgement.

We get together during the school term for games, Bible study, prayer, worship nights, excursions and more. We also have a youth camp that is heaps of fun. 

Our leaders have undergone Child Safe training and have hearts for connecting with youth. We also have joint activities with local churches in our region across the year.

Playgroup

Playgroup runs on Monday and Friday mornings between 9:30-11 am at our Eltham campus, with playtime in our back room with lots of toys and fun craft activities. It is open to children aged from babies to preschoolers (subject to availability), and provides parents and carers an opportunity to connect with other families in the community.

All volunteers at TVBC have undergone Child Safe training.
